Indian national Lalita Gupte has been proposed as new board member of Nokia. Other nominations include CEO of SAP AG & Nokia.

New Delhi: Indian national Lalita D Gupte was Monday proposed as new board member of the Finnish-based telecommunications group Nokia.

Gupte is a former joint managing director of India's second largest bank, ICICI Bank, in addition to her current position as non-executive chairman of the ICICI Venture Funds Management, she is also board member of Bharat Forge, Firstsource Solutions and Kirloskar Brothers, Nokia said.

In all Nokia, the world's largest maker of mobile telephones was slated to have 11 board members.

Other new nominations were German national Henning Kagermann, chief executive of business software provider SAP AG, and current Nokia Chief Executive Olli-Pekka Kallasvuo.

Kallasvuo's predecessor Jorma Ollila, the current Nokia chairman, was among the eight board members proposed to be re-elected at the annual general meeting May 3.

Vice board chairman, US national Paul J Collins, board member since 1998, was due to step down at the annual general meeting since turning 70 - the board's retirement, Nokia said.
